  • And a two-tier market is emerging, a China tier and a new non-China tier. The two price differently, contract differently and behave differently. We're building USA Rare Earth to anchor the non-China tier and to be its partner of choice. Outside of China, heavy rare earths used in magnets are scarcer today than at any point in recent memory, and pricing reflects this reality.

    同時,一個雙層市場正在形成:中國層級與新的非中國層級。兩者在定價、合約模式與市場行為上都不同。我們打造 USA Rare Earth 的目標,是成為非中國層級的支柱,並成為其首選合作夥伴。在中國以外,用於磁鐵的重稀土如今比近年任何時候都更稀缺,價格也反映了這個現實。

  • Western prices for dysprosium oxide, for example, are up over 90% in 2026 alone as measured by Benchmark Minerals intelligence, reaching nearly $2,000 per kilogram in August, over 9x the price of the product in China. This same tightness runs across other rare earths and critical minerals, such as lutetium, gallium, Gadolinium, hafnium and zirconium and Yttrium. Western prices for Yttrium oxide which has only started to be tracked within the last year since, it essentially does not exist outside in the West, has risen or 60% since March and is over 200x the price in China.

    以氧化鏑為例,根據 Benchmark Minerals Intelligence 的衡量,西方價格僅在 2026 年就上漲超過 90%,8 月已接近每公斤 2,000 美元,超過中國同類產品價格的 9 倍。這種供應吃緊同樣出現在其他稀土與關鍵礦物上,例如鑥、鎵、釓、鉿、鋯以及釔。西方的氧化釔價格——由於其在西方幾乎不存在,直到過去一年才開始被追蹤——自 3 月以來已上漲 60%,且價格已超過中國的 200 倍。

  • A mine without processing is a stranded asset. Processing without metal and alloy making capability is a science project. A magnet manufacturing facility without a secure heavy rare earth feedstock in zombie and tolling any of these steps through an adversary is a bottleneck. That is why we have to link this chain together and why we moved so urgently to build capability at each link.

    只有礦、沒有加工能力,資產就會被擱淺;只有加工、沒有金屬與合金製造能力,就只是科學專案;而沒有穩定重稀土原料來源的磁鐵製造設施,則形同「殭屍」產能;此外,若把任何一步透過對手進行代工(tolling),都會形成瓶頸。因此,我們必須把這條鏈串起來,也因此我們才會如此急迫地在每一個環節建立能力。

  • We will continue to move at pace, and we will not sacrifice our values to do it. Turning to our Q2 results. Revenues for the quarter, which represents sales to third parties were approximately $6 million derived from our metal and alloy making business at LCM. Gross margins were impacted by higher raw material input costs, which are associated with the supply challenges that the entire industry is facing.

    我們將持續保持速度前進,也不會為了速度而犧牲我們的價值觀。接著談我們第二季(Q2)業績。本季營收(代表對第三方的銷售)約為 600 萬美元,主要來自 LCM 的金屬與合金製造業務。毛利率受到較高原材料投入成本的影響,而這與整個產業正面臨的供應挑戰有關。

  • This issue is most acute in heavy rare earths, and we are actively engaging with alternative supply sources ahead of our anticipated access to feedstock from Serra Verde and Carester. As a result, our position in the supply-constrained market conditions provides the opportunity to establish appropriate non-China pricing. And because of what we've been building here at USA Rare Earth, we have considerable market insight.

    這個問題在重稀土(heavy rare earths)上最為嚴重;在我們預期可取得 Serra Verde 與 Carester 供料之前,我們正積極接洽替代供應來源。因此,在供應受限的市場環境下,我們的市場地位提供了建立適當「非中國」定價的機會。而且,基於我們在 USA Rare Earth 所打造的一切,我們對市場有相當深入的洞察。

  • Therefore, we believe there is an opportunity for positive momentum in pricing to develop going forward. Operating expenses in the quarter were approximately $45 million, including higher M&A legal and consulting costs related to our highly strategic global transactions. This was partially offset by lower R&D costs compared to the first-quarter as our magnet business moved into production in the second-quarter and associated costs are now reflected in inventory rather than R&D.

    因此,我們認為未來定價有機會形成正向動能。本季營業費用約為 4,500 萬美元,其中包含與我們高度策略性的全球交易相關、較高的併購(M&A)法律與顧問費用。相較第一季,研發費用下降,部分抵銷了上述增加;因為我們的磁材業務在第二季進入生產階段,相關成本現在反映在存貨中,而非研發費用。

  • We reported a net loss attributable to common stockholders of $10.3 million or $0.05 per share. This includes a noncash fair value adjustment of approximately $22.4 million related to our warrant and earn-out liabilities. Excluding this, our adjusted net loss was $33.5 million or $0.15 per share. Turning to the balance sheet. We ended the quarter with approximately $1.5 billion in cash and cash equivalents.

    我們報告歸屬於普通股股東的淨損為 1,030 萬美元,或每股 0.05 美元。其中包含約 2,240 萬美元的非現金公允價值調整,與我們的認股權證(warrant)及或有對價(earn-out)負債相關。排除該項後,我們的調整後淨損為 3,350 萬美元,或每股 0.15 美元。接著看資產負債表:本季末我們持有約 15 億美元的現金及約當現金。

  • This financing is a milestone-based CapEx reimbursement program meaning we are reimbursed only after we achieve specific milestones. In our view, this protects the US taxpayer and aligns private capital with government investment. We expect to apply for our first reimbursement distribution in the coming months. At the same time, we continue to build out our platform in line with the long-term schedule we laid out in January to all stakeholders, with Round Top targeting commercial operations in late 2028 and 10,000 tons of both metal and alloy and magnet manufacturing capacity in the United States by 2029.

    這項融資是一個以里程碑為基礎的資本支出(CapEx)補償計畫,意即只有在我們達成特定里程碑後才會獲得補償。我們認為,這能保護美國納稅人,並使民間資本與政府投資方向一致。我們預期在未來幾個月申請第一筆補償款。同時,我們也持續依照 1 月向所有利害關係人所提出的長期時程建置平台:Round Top 目標於 2028 年底進入商業營運,並於 2029 年在美國達成金屬與合金以及磁材製造產能各 10,000 噸。

  • Now to operations. This quarter at Round Top, we began the resource upgrade drilling program, drilling over 10,000 feet of additional core across the 3-rig campaign. Early assay results are in line with our expectations for resource grade and confirm heavy rare distribution above 70%. The definitive feasibility study remains on track for year-end completion and publication of the S-K 1300 in early 2027.

    接著談營運。本季在 Round Top,我們啟動資源升級鑽探計畫,在三台鑽機的作業中額外鑽取超過 10,000 英尺的岩心。初步化驗(assay)結果符合我們對資源品位的預期,並確認重稀土分布占比高於 70%。最終可行性研究(definitive feasibility study)仍按計畫於年底完成,並於 2027 年初發布 S-K 1300。

  • At our Wheat Ridge R&D headquarters, the hydrometallurgical facility is now offering all three demonstration circuits, the Round Top flow sheet, third-party MREC separation, and magnet swarf recycling. Data from these circuits will feed both our definitive feasibility study for Round Top and the design and engineering of our consolidated separation plan.

    在我們位於 Wheat Ridge 的研發總部,濕法冶金設施目前已提供三條示範迴路:Round Top 流程(flow sheet)、第三方 MREC 分離,以及磁材切屑(swarf)回收。這些迴路的數據將同時用於 Round Top 的最終可行性研究,以及我們整合分離廠(consolidated separation plant)的設計與工程。

  • Got it. Got it. And as my follow-up, it seems like the recycling technology that you're working on in Wheat Ridge seems to be progressing. I was curious if you can maybe share what portion of the feedstock do you guys expect to come from sort of that recycling versus kind of newly mined? Any detail on that would be great.

    了解,了解。那我的追問是,看起來你們在 Wheat Ridge 推進的回收技術正在進展。我想請問你們預期原料(feedstock)中有多少比例會來自這類回收,而不是新開採的?任何細節都很有幫助。

  • William Steele - Chief Financial Officer

    William Steele - Chief Financial Officer

  • Yes. So swarf generally speaking will represent 20% to 30% of our finished magnets. So in theory, if we're producing 10,000 metric tons and all of those magnets are finished, then we might generate a couple of thousand metric tons of swarf per year. That swarf can be taken and then recycled back into essentially raw material oxides that can be turned into metal and then back into magnets. So it could end up being as much as 20% to 30% of our supply going forward.

    好的。所以一般而言,切屑粉(swarf)將占我們成品磁鐵的 20% 到 30%。因此理論上,如果我們生產 10,000 公噸且這些磁鐵都是成品,那麼我們每年可能會產生數千公噸的切屑粉。這些切屑粉可以被回收,基本上再轉回原料氧化物(raw material oxides),再製成金屬,然後再回到磁鐵。因此未來它最終可能占我們供應的 20% 到 30%。
